Hi,
I'm running fully uptodate Ubuntu 10.04 and have the following problem
with my DVB-T USB stick Terratec Cinergy T USB XXS (dib0700).
The DVB-T stick is always attached to my PC and sometimes it doesn't
work properly. Meaning I get a I/O error message while trying to watch
TV with Kaffeine player (s. below DiB0070 I2C read failed). More over if
I disconnect the stick there are NO messages about that events in
kernel.log and any other USD device shows the same behavior - it doesn't
work and there are no messages in reknel.log by connecting or
disconnecting it.
I noticed that this happens every time when the stick immediately found
in warm state and the step of loading the firmware (dvb-usb-
dib0700-1.20.fw) is missing.

In the second case the stick was found in cold state, the firmware
loaded and ONLY THEN the device was found in warm state.
In the second it was found immediately in warm state. So the firmware
isn't loaded, what somehow leads to my usb hub not working anymore. Then
I have to reboot my PC in order to get it working again.
